Combined Events Start Strong In Arizona

TUCSON, Ariz. - University of Colorado sophomore Brianne Beemer raced her way to the top of the CU combined events record book, posting a school record in the 800-meter run of the heptathlon on Friday afternoon at the Jim Click Shootout.

Beemer recorded a time of 2 minutes, 13.20 seconds to beat the runner-up, Arizona State's Keia Pinnick, by 3.81 seconds. She now holds four of the seven highest times posted by a CU female in the combined events 800. The previous record was held by Heather Sterlin who ran 2:14.80 on June 4, 1997.

Beemer scored 4,669 points to finish seventh overall in the heptathlon. In addition to her first-place finish in the 800, she tied for sixth in the high jump (5-01.75) and was seventh in the 100-meter hurdles (15.63).

Beemer was not the only Buff to excel in the 800-meters as fellow sophomore Katie Dreher notched a personal record of 2:20.14. Dreher's time is the 12th best in CU history for the combined 800. Dreher finished ninth in the 100-meter hurdles (15.94), sixth in the long jump (17-01.50), and seventh in the javelin (104-02), all personal records. Dreher finished with 4,515 points, placing her ninth.

Sophomore Alyssa Frank finished 11th overall with 3,558 points. Frank had a personal best in the shot put on Thursday with a throw of 33-7.50, good for sixth place. She also PR'd in the javelin (102-05) and took eighth.

Volunteer assistant coach Emily Pearson took second in the heptathlon with 5,322 points. She won the javelin with a throw of 138-10. Pearson was second in the 200 (25.34) and took third in the 100 hurdles (14.26), high jump (5-05.25) and shot put (39-04).

Adam Salzmann scored 6,739 points in the men's decathlon to lead the Buffalo men. Highlighting his performance was a second-place finish in the 1500. Salzmann's time of 4:25.92 is a personal record and marks the third best combined events 1500 time recorded at CU. Salzmann also set PRs in the pole vault (14-09) and javelin (154-10) where he finished fourth and eighth, respectively. Salzmann's mark in the pole vault tied for the third best by a CU combined events athlete.

Eddie Taylor (6,168 points) and Alex Von Hagen (5,919) also competed in the decathlon and placed tenth and 13th, respectively. Taylor was 13th in the long jump (20-03.00), ninth in the shot put (38-00.75), eighth in the high jump (5-11.25), tenth in the discus (110-08), and third in the 1500 (4:35.39), recording personal records in each event. Taylor's shot put distance is the 11th best in combined events history at CU, and his time in the 1500 is the tenth fastest.

Von Hagen notched personal records in the discus (118-10) and shot put (37-02.25), placing seventh and tenth, respectively. Von Hagen also finished third in the high jump by clearing 6-04, which tied for eighth highest in CU combined events. 

Other members of the CU track and field team will compete at the Tom Benich Invitational on Saturday in Greeley, Colo.
